Str-1.w Structurescombineintextstoemphasizecertainideas And Concepts.fig-1.m Descriptive Words, Such As Adjectives And Adverbs, Qualifyormodifythethingstheydescribeandaffect Readers’ Interaction With The Text. Fig-1.n Hyperbole Exaggerates While Understatement Minimizes.exaggeratingorminimizinganaspectofan Object Focuses Attention On That Trait And Conveys A Perspective About The Object.

“In the sentence "The shimmering blue ocean sparkled under the bright sun," identify the adjectives and adverbs. Explain how they contribute to the overall imagery and understanding of the scene. Analyze the sentence "The old, creaky house stood silently in the dark forest." Identify the descriptive words and discuss how they shape the reader's perception of the house and its surroundings.”
